An inviting expedition across our galactic neighbourhood, from Mercury to the Sun’s furthest satellites, complete with the latest discoveries.

The Space Age probes to the Moon, Venus and Mars ushered in a golden age of planetary science, transforming planets from distant mysteries into vividly realised worlds. This book provides a comprehensive, accessible survey of the entire solar system, covering all major planets from Mercury to Saturn, the outer solar system and asteroids. It includes insights from leading scientists through in-person interviews, offering an engaging overview for general readers and amateur astronomers.

Noting Earth’s small, beautiful and precarious nature, this book fills a unique niche, presenting the latest discoveries without losing sight of the broader picture, making it essential for anyone interested in our celestial neighbourhood.

William Sheehan

William Sheehan is a noted historian of astronomy, writer and retired psychiatrist. His books include Mercury (2018), Saturn (2019) and Venus (2022) in Reaktion’s Kosmos series. He lives in Arizona, and asteroid 16037 is named Sheehan in his honour.

Clifford J. Cunningham

Clifford J. Cunningham is a Research Fellow at the University of Southern Queensland and Associate Editor of the Journal of Astronomical History and Heritage.

His books include Asteroids (2021) in Reaktion’s Kosmos series. Asteroid 4276 (Clifford) is named in his honour.
